
Consumer Electronics
•04 min read
Unlock the full potential of your Raspberry Pi by seamlessly connecting it to your Mac. Whether you are a hobbyist, developer, or tech enthusiast, mastering this connection opens doors to endless possibilities. In this guide, you will learn how to remotely connect to Raspberry Pi from Mac using a straightforward checklist. The step-by-step process covers setting up SSH for command-line access, utilising VNC for a graphical user interface, sharing files securely, and troubleshooting common issues, all on your Mac.
Ensure you have these essentials before starting your journey: Raspberry Pi (any model), a Mac computer, a MicroSD card with Raspberry Pi OS installed, a power supply for your Raspberry Pi, and either an Ethernet cable or a reliable Wi-Fi connection. This setup helps you quickly get connected and control your Raspberry Pi from a Mac.
For your Mac, you will need the Terminal app, a VNC Viewer, and optionally, Microsoft Remote Desktop. On the Raspberry Pi itself, ensure the SSH server is enabled and install TightVNC server. These software tools enable remote access, control, and file sharing, all while reinforcing a secure and efficient connection environment.
Begin by accessing the Raspberry Pi settings and enabling SSH. To find the Raspberry Pi's IP address, use the terminal command or refer to your router’s device list. This critical piece of information lets you connect remotely using a secure terminal session.
Launch the Terminal application on your Mac and enter the following command:
ssh pi@[IP address]
Authenticate using your Raspberry Pi's password, whether it is the default or a customised credential. This process outlines the Mac to Raspberry Pi SSH setup effortlessly.
After connecting, confirm the success by accessing the Raspberry Pi command line through your Mac Terminal. This proves that your remote login to the Raspberry Pi from Mac is secure and effective.
Using the command line, install the TightVNC server on your Raspberry Pi and set up a secure password. This configuration is essential for establishing a reliable VNC Raspberry Pi Mac connection.
Install the VNC Viewer on your Mac. Once installed, input your Raspberry Pi's IP address along with the pre-set password to form a secure and stable connection.
With VNC Viewer, enjoy graphical remote access to your Raspberry Pi desktop. This method allows you to control Raspberry Pi from Mac in a more visual and intuitive manner.
Utilise SCP (Secure Copy Protocol) for transferring files between your devices. For instance, the command scp filename pi@[IP address]:/destination/path enables secure file sharing on your Raspberry Pi Mac terminal access. This method is an ideal solution for those looking to easily manage documents or projects on different devices.
Configure your Raspberry Pi for a Wi-Fi connection. Once set up, you can use the same SSH and VNC configurations as you would on a wired network. This offers a flexible approach to remote access raspberry pi from mac, making your setup truly wireless and adaptable.
If you encounter connection errors during the SSH setup, first verify that your Raspberry Pi's IP address is correct. Ensure SSH is enabled on the Pi and double-check any firewall settings on your Mac that might be restricting access.
Troubleshoot by confirming that the TightVNC server is running on your Raspberry Pi, and check that the IP address and password entered on the VNC Viewer match those configured on the Pi.
If file transfers via SCP fail, inspect the file paths and permissions on your Raspberry Pi. Also, ensure your network connectivity is solid, especially when handling larger files.
Pro Tip: Optimize Your Raspberry Pi Connection
Did you know? For enhanced security, always change the default SSH password on your Raspberry Pi and use SSH keys for authentication. This simple step is key to preventing unauthorised access and keeping your device safe.
Use the hostname -I command on your Raspberry Pi or check your router's connected devices list.
Yes, by enabling SSH during the initial setup, you can connect to your Raspberry Pi remotely from your Mac without needing a dedicated monitor.
SSH gives you command-line access while VNC provides a graphical interface for controlling your Raspberry Pi desktop.
File transfers can be securely executed via SCP (Secure Copy Protocol) in the terminal, or through a network file-sharing system.
Absolutely. Configure your Raspberry Pi for Wi-Fi access and use SSH or VNC as you normally would for a wired connection.
This essential checklist ensures that you know exactly how to remotely connect your Raspberry Pi to your Mac. By following the outlined steps, you achieve reliable access—from setting up command-line tools like SSH for mac terminal access, to enjoying a full desktop experience with a VNC Raspberry Pi Mac connection. Furthermore, leveraging secure file sharing and wireless connectivity broadens your ability to control Raspberry Pi from Mac anywhere in your home or workspace.
Much like the benefits provided by platforms such as Tata Neu—where users earn NeuCoins rewards on every smart transaction—you too can enjoy the advantages of a seamless and efficient tech set-up. With Tata Neu supporting various categories such as gadgets and appliances, you can experience expert guidance and reliable support. The same care and attention applied in your tech setups is mirrored in every transaction on Tata Neu, ensuring that every step is smooth and secure.
By following this guide and utilising the stated steps, you are well equipped to explore the full potential of your Raspberry Pi and Mac connection. Enjoy remote access, enhanced file sharing, and smooth troubleshooting, while embracing a tech journey that is both secure and inspiring.